Abel

Director: Diego Luna

Mexico • 2010 • 82 mins • Drama • English subtitles


Actor Diego Luna’s (Rudi y Cursi) accomplished debut feature is an unusual tale of family dynamics and patriarchy. Abel is a troubled nine-year-old boy who has suffered a breakdown and retreated into silence, apparently as a result of his father abandoning the family. When his mother Cecilia brings him home from the psychiatric ward, Abel begins inhabiting the persona of the absentee dad. The family plays along and bizarrely the charade works; Abel’s fear about his family is transformed and their desire for a father figure is satisfied. Luna expertly handles the subject matter and the result makes for an intriguing and humorous family drama.
